    柯林斯高阶英汉双解学习词典释义
    • N-UNCOUNT
      淤伤;青肿
      If someone has bruising on their body, they have bruises on it.
      例句
      She had quite severe bruising and a cut lip. 她身上有严重的淤伤,嘴唇也破了。
    • ADJ-GRADED
      头破血流的;激烈的
      In a bruising battle or encounter, people fight or compete with each other in a very aggressive or determined way.
      例句
      The administration hopes to avoid another bruising battle over civil rights. 政府希望避免因民权问题再次发生激烈冲突。
